"The attributes appear in SORT_ORDER, so the lowest of the two sort orders will be the attribute to the LEFT of the grid, and the last will be the TOP of the grid."
What more is there to say? If you have two attributes, one with a sort order of 10 and one with a sort order of 50, the one with the value 10 will appear to the left (rows), and the one with the value of 50 will appear across the top (columns).
If you have vlaues of 1 and -100, the 1 will appear at the top (columns) and the -100 will appear to the side (rows).

@charagg - the lauout you want to copy is achievable with this module, however, you will need to change some of the code, as the current module doesn't support model numbers, sizes etc. If you want to edit these details, you should take a look at the includes/modules/YOUR_TEMPLATE/attributes.php file. This is the file which builds the table structure as a string, ready for output.
You also want to change the sort order of your attributes, so that QTY becomes the heading of the rows.
